Transaction f50c697372713ec2376e477c44b74ca012f0d22a33ec1e4379ce6575e2ef3e77

3 Input
2 Outputs
  • f50c697372713ec2376e477c44b74ca012f0d22a33ec1e4379ce6575e2ef3e77:0
  • value  1390248464
    address  bc1qlaqlu223pts947wpf7xk99cgekmz24097afkdt
  • f50c697372713ec2376e477c44b74ca012f0d22a33ec1e4379ce6575e2ef3e77:1
  • value  104328586
    address  35iMHbUZeTssxBodiHwEEkb32jpBfVueEL